The crucial role of spark plugs in engine operation
Ignition of the fuel mixture
The main role of spark plugs is the precise ignition of the air-fuel mixture in the combustion chamber. This is achieved through a high-voltage electric spark generated by an ignition coil. The coil transforms the 12V from the battery into thousands of volts required to produce the spark.
Timing of this ignition is crucial - the spark must occur at the exact moment when the piston is at top dead center and the mixture has the optimal composition. An improper or uneven ignition can cause:
- Misfires
- Power loss
- Higher fuel consumption
- Higher emissions
Heat dissipation from the combustion chamber
The second role, equally important, is the transfer of heat from the combustion chamber to the engine block. Spark plugs act as tiny radiators, removing a significant portion of the heat generated by combustion. This function prevents localized overheating and protects the engine from damage.

Advantages of high-quality spark plugs
Advanced construction materials
Premium spark plugs use superior materials that resist the harsh conditions inside the engine:
- Electrodes of iridium or platinum: These noble metals resist wear and corrosion, maintaining the optimal gap between electrodes for longer periods
- High-quality ceramic: Advanced ceramic insulators better resist thermal and mechanical shocks
- Improved sealing gaps: Prevent gas and oil leaks into the ignition system
Consistent long-term performance
Spark plugs of quality offer:
- More efficient ignition: Stronger and more stable spark
- Improved acceleration response: More responsive and smooth engine
- Easier starting: In all weather conditions
- Reduced emissions: More complete combustion
Risks of low-quality spark plugs
Choosing cheap spark plugs may seem economical at first glance, but hidden costs are significant:
Performance issues
- Frequent misfires: The engine stumbles and runs unevenly
- Difficult starting: Especially in cold conditions
- Power loss: Acceleration becomes slow and sluggish
- Higher fuel consumption: Incomplete combustion wastes fuel
Long-term costs
Although they appear cheaper at first, low-quality plugs:
- Wear out faster, requiring frequent replacements
- Can cause damage to other components (ignition coils, catalytic converter)
- Increase fuel consumption and operating costs
- May leave the driver stranded at inconvenient moments
Accelerated engine wear
Poor ignition affects the entire engine through:
- Carbon deposits in the combustion chamber
- Premature wear of pistons and rings
- Deterioration of the catalytic converter due to unburned gases
- Additional strain on the fuel delivery system
How to choose the right spark plugs
To achieve the best results:
- Follow the manufacturer’s specifications: Thermal rating and spark plug type should match the recommendations
- Choose reputable brands: NGK, Bosch, Champion, Denso are well-known manufacturers
- Invest in modern technologies: Spark plugs with iridium or platinum electrodes last longer
- Replace the full set: Don’t replace only the faulty plugs; replace the entire set for uniform performance
